# Connection pooling settings for the Larkspine reporting service.
# Pool size is capped at 20 because the Quillbore cluster throttles
# anything beyond that during nightly aggregation. Idle connections
# are recycled after 300 seconds; do not lower this without checking
# with the data platform team, since the warm-up cost is significant.
# Release managers: bump the pool version comment on each deploy so
# audits stay clean. The pool authenticates using the connection
# string that follows on the next line.

replica DSN, kajep-yahag: mssql://praok_svc:iF@db-8d68.plorvaio.local:5432/eliion

Subject: Calder Unit Sale — Where We Stand

Team,

Quick update before Thursday's call. The Calder instrumentation unit sale to Bryntham Holdings is moving faster than expected — diligence wrapped early and their board meets next week. Priya's group has the transition staffing plan drafted; please review your department's exposure by Friday. Keep chatter to a minimum until signatures land. For the heads of department only, the confidential outline of what happens after close appears directly below.

management briefing: Sorethox Works is in early talks to buy Gilokek Systems for about $17.6 million. The Aldeth launch date is November 10, and nothing goes to the press before then.

## Changelog — Ticktrace 1.9

### Renamed: DRIFT_API_TOKEN
During the cron drift investigation we found plugins confusing this variable with the metrics token, so it has been renamed to indicate it authorizes drift-report uploads specifically. Plugin authors must read the new name from 1.9 onward; the old name is ignored without warning. Sample env files in the SDK are updated. In your deployment env file, the drift-report upload secret is set on the next line.

env line for fawef-taguf: VAULT_KEY13=a9695905a9a90

Hey! Quick heads-up before Thursday's sync: you've inherited the Scrapheap sweeper, our orphaned-resource cleanup job. It runs every six hours and deletes volumes, snapshots, and load balancers with no living owner tag. Mostly it's boring, but if the `orphans_found` count spikes above a few hundred, pause it and ping the platform channel — that usually means a tagging pipeline broke, not an actual orphan flood. The pause switch, dry-run mode, and escalation steps are all documented on the internal ops page.

operations page: https://jenkins.zemvarcloud.local/job/merge_requests/repo/build/73930b4b30f0a8ed